What is a softwash system?

A softwash system is a method of cleaning that uses low pressure and specialized cleaning solutions to remove dirt, grime, mold, and other contaminants from surfaces. Unlike pressure washing, which uses high pressure water to blast away debris, softwashing is more gentle and less likely to cause damage to delicate surfaces such as siding, roofing, and windows.

Benefits of Using a softwash system

1. Gentle on Surfaces: One of the main benefits of a softwash system is that it is gentle on surfaces. Traditional pressure washing can be too harsh for certain materials, leading to damage or discoloration. Softwashing, on the other hand, uses low pressure and specialized cleaning solutions to gently remove dirt and grime without causing any harm to the surface.

2. Effective Cleaning: Despite its gentle approach, a softwash system is highly effective at cleaning a wide range of surfaces. Whether you need to clean your siding, roof, deck, or driveway, a softwash system can remove stubborn stains, mold, mildew, and other contaminants with ease.

3. Longer Lasting Results: Softwashing not only cleans surfaces effectively, but it also provides longer lasting results. The specialized cleaning solutions used in a softwash system help to kill mold, mildew, and algae at the root, preventing regrowth and keeping your surfaces looking clean for longer.

4. Environmentally Friendly: Traditional pressure washing can be harmful to the environment, as the high pressure water can wash harmful chemicals and contaminants into the soil and water supply. Softwashing, on the other hand, uses biodegradable cleaning solutions that are safe for the environment, making it a more eco-friendly option for cleaning your home.

5. Cost Effective: While it may seem like pressure washing is the faster and more cost effective option, a softwash system can actually save you money in the long run. By preventing damage to your surfaces, you can avoid costly repairs and replacements, extending the life of your home’s exterior.

How to Use a softwash system

Using a softwash system is simple and can be done by most homeowners with the right equipment and cleaning solutions. Here are some steps to follow when using a softwash system:

1. Prepare the area to be cleaned by removing any furniture, plants, or other obstacles.

2. Mix the cleaning solution according to the manufacturer’s instructions and fill the softwash system tank.

3. Start at the top of the surface you are cleaning and work your way down, applying the cleaning solution in a sweeping motion.

4. Allow the cleaning solution to sit for a few minutes to break down dirt and grime.

5. Rinse the surface clean with low pressure water, being careful not to spray directly at windows or other delicate surfaces.

6. Repeat the process as needed to achieve the desired level of cleanliness.
